• DocumentCode
    494467
  • Title

    Software Architecture in Industrial Applications

  • Author

    Soni, Dilip ; Nord, Robert L. ; Hofmeister, Christine

  • Author_Institution
    Siemens Corporate Research Inc., Princeton, NJ
  • fYear
    1995
  • fDate
    23-30 April 1995
  • Firstpage
    196
  • Lastpage
    196
  • Abstract
    To help us identify and focus on pragmatic and concrete issues related to the role of software architecture in large systems, we conducted a survey of a variety of software systems used in industrial applications. Our premise, which guided the examination of these systems, was that software architecture is concerned with capturing the structures of a system and the relationships among the elements both within and between structures. The structures we found fell into several broad categories: conceptual architecture, module interconnection architecture, code architecture, and execution architecture. These categories address different engineering concerns. The separation of such concerns, combined with specialized implementation techniques, decreased the complexity of implementation, and improved reuse and reconfiguration.
  • Keywords
    Application software; Computer industry; Software architecture; Software engineering;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Software Engineering, 1995. ICSE 1995. 17th International Conference on
  • Conference_Location
    Seattle, Washington, USA
  • ISSN
    0270-5257
  • Print_ISBN
    0-89791-708-1
  • Type

    conf

  • Filename
    5071105